Famous Indian Beverages You Can Enjoy on a Hot Day
India is known for its diverse culture and cuisine, and its beverages are no exception. On a hot day, nothing beats refreshing Indian drinks that can help you beat the heat. Here, we explore some of the most famous Indian beverages that you can enjoy during those sweltering summer months.
1. Masala Chai
Masala Chai, or spiced tea, is a quintessential Indian beverage enjoyed by millions across the country. This aromatic drink is made by brewing black tea with a mix of spices like cardamom, ginger, and cloves, often sweetened with sugar and complemented by milk. Served hot or cold, Masala Chai can offer a refreshing twist on a sunny day when iced.
2. Lassi
Lassi is a traditional yogurt-based drink that comes in various flavors, most notably sweet and salted. Sweet lassi, mixed with sugar and flavored with cardamom or fruit like mango, can be a delightful source of hydration. On a hot day, salted lassi offers a tangy twist and is often garnished with cumin or mint. It’s an excellent way to cool down while enjoying a healthy option.
3. Aam Panna
Aam Panna is a tangy and refreshing drink made from green mangoes. Traditionally prepared during the summer months, it combines boiled and mashed mango with spices like cumin, mentha leaves, and sugar, resulting in a uniquely tangy flavor. This drink not only quenches your thirst but also provides essential vitamins and minerals.
4. Nimbu Pani
Nimbu Pani, or lemon water, is an everyday drink loved for its simplicity and refreshing qualities. Made by mixing fresh lemon juice, water, sugar, and a pinch of salt, it’s an excellent source of hydration and vitamin C. You can also enhance its flavor by adding mint leaves or ginger, making it even more refreshing.
5. Coconut Water
Coconut water is the ultimate natural electrolyte drink, perfect for combating dehydration in the summer heat. It is not only refreshingly sweet but also packed with essential nutrients like potassium and magnesium. Enjoying coconut water straight from the coconut provides a delightful tropical experience that’s hard to beat on a hot day.
6. Falooda
Falooda is a traditional Indian dessert beverage that combines sweet basil seeds, vermicelli noodles, and rose syrup topped with ice cream. It’s a delightful mix of flavors and textures, making it an indulgent and refreshing option for those scorching summer afternoons. The creamy ice cream paired with the rose-flavored liquid creates a cooling effect that's perfect for relaxing.
7. Thandai
Thandai is a festive beverage often associated with Holi, but it's enjoyed throughout the summer for its refreshing qualities. Made from a mix of milk, nuts, spices, and sugar, and often flavored with saffron, it is not only delicious but also cooling, making it great for hot days. Thandai can be served chilled, with ice, for maximum refreshment.
8. Buttermilk (Chaas)
Buttermilk, or Chaas, is a popular drink in India, especially in rural areas, made from diluting yogurt with water. Often flavored with spices like cumin and coriander, and sometimes garnished with mint leaves, this drink is both savory and refreshing. It’s an excellent digestive aid, making it a perfect accompaniment to your summer meals.
